u/LX_Luna 24d ago

1) That would be tremendously more expensive than digging silos.

2) You need several such subs to have credible deterrence.

3) The UK does not manufacture the ICBMs that go into their submarines. Their warheads are fitted to UGM-133A Trident IIs which are manufactured in the United States.
